package config
import (
"fmt"
"io/ioutil"
"os"
"os/exec"
"os/user"
"path/filepath"
"runtime"
"sync"
"github.com/photoprism/photoprism/pkg/clean"
"github.com/photoprism/photoprism/pkg/fs"
"github.com/photoprism/photoprism/pkg/rnd"
)
// binPaths stores known executable paths.
var (
binPaths = make(map[string]string, 8)
binMu = sync.RWMutex{}
tempPath = ""
)
// findBin resolves the absolute file path of external binaries.
func findBin(configBin, defaultBin string) (binPath string) {
cacheKey := defaultBin + configBin
binMu.RLock()
cached, found := binPaths[cacheKey]
binMu.RUnlock()
// Already found?
if found {
return cached
}
// Default binary name?
if configBin == "" {
binPath = defaultBin
} else {
binPath = configBin
}
// Search for binary.
if path, err := exec.LookPath(binPath); err == nil {
binPath = path
}
// Found?
if !fs.FileExists(binPath) {
binPath = ""
} else {
binMu.Lock()
binPaths[cacheKey] = binPath
binMu.Unlock()
}
return binPath
}
// CreateDirectories creates directories for storing photos, metadata and cache files.
func (c *Config) CreateDirectories() error {
// Error if the originals and storage path are identical.
if c.OriginalsPath() == c.StoragePath() {
return fmt.Errorf("originals and storage folder must be different directories")
}
// Make sure that the configured storage path exists and initialize it with
// ".ppstorage" and ".ppignore files" so that it is not accidentally indexed.
if dir := c.StoragePath(); dir == "" {
return notFoundError("storage")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
} else if _, err = fs.WriteUnixTime(filepath.Join(dir, fs.PPStorageFilename)); err != nil {
return fmt.Errorf("%s file in %s could not be created", fs.PPStorageFilename, clean.Log(dir))
} else if err = fs.WriteString(filepath.Join(dir, fs.PPIgnoreFilename), fs.PPIgnoreAll); err != nil {
return fmt.Errorf("%s file in %s could not be created", fs.PPIgnoreFilename, clean.Log(dir))
}
// Create originals path if it does not exist yet and return an error if it could be a storage folder.
if dir := c.OriginalsPath(); dir == "" {
return notFoundError("originals")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
} else if fs.FileExists(filepath.Join(dir, fs.PPStorageFilename)) {
return fmt.Errorf("found a %s file in the originals path", fs.PPStorageFilename)
}
// Create import path if it does not exist yet and return an error if it could be a storage folder.
if dir := c.ImportPath(); dir == "" {
return notFoundError("import")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
} else if fs.FileExists(filepath.Join(dir, fs.PPStorageFilename)) {
return fmt.Errorf("found a %s file in the import path", fs.PPStorageFilename)
}
// Create storage path if it doesn't exist yet.
if dir := c.UsersStoragePath(); dir == "" {
return notFoundError("users storage")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create assets path if it doesn't exist yet.
if dir := c.AssetsPath(); dir == "" {
return notFoundError("assets")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create command cache storage path if it doesn't exist yet.
if dir := c.CmdCachePath(); dir == "" {
return notFoundError("cmd cache")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create backup base path if it doesn't exist yet.
if dir := c.BackupBasePath(); dir == "" {
return notFoundError("backup")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create sidecar storage path if it doesn't exist yet.
if dir := c.SidecarPath(); filepath.IsAbs(dir) {
if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
}
// Create and initialize cache storage directory.
if dir := c.CachePath(); dir == "" {
return notFoundError("cache")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(c.CachePath(), err)
} else if err = fs.WriteString(filepath.Join(dir, fs.PPIgnoreFilename), fs.PPIgnoreAll); err != nil {
return fmt.Errorf("%s file in %s could not be created", fs.PPIgnoreFilename, clean.Log(dir))
}
// Create media cache storage path if it doesn't exist yet.
if dir := c.MediaCachePath(); dir == "" {
return notFoundError("media")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create thumbnail cache storage path if it doesn't exist yet.
if dir := c.ThumbCachePath(); dir == "" {
return notFoundError("thumbs")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create and initialize config directory.
if dir := c.ConfigPath(); dir == "" {
return notFoundError("config")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
} else if err = fs.WriteString(filepath.Join(dir, fs.PPIgnoreFilename), fs.PPIgnoreAll); err != nil {
return fmt.Errorf("%s file in %s could not be created", fs.PPIgnoreFilename, clean.Log(dir))
}
// Create certificates config path if it doesn't exist yet.
if dir := c.CertificatesPath(); dir == "" {
return notFoundError("certificates")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create temporary file path if it doesn't exist yet.
if dir := c.TempPath(); dir == "" {
return notFoundError("temp")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create albums backup path if it doesn't exist yet.
if dir := c.BackupAlbumsPath(); dir == "" {
return notFoundError("albums")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create TensorFlow model path if it doesn't exist yet.
if dir := c.TensorFlowModelPath(); dir == "" {
return notFoundError("tensorflow model")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
// Create frontend build path if it doesn't exist yet.
if dir := c.BuildPath(); dir == "" {
return notFoundError("build")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
if dir := filepath.Dir(c.PIDFilename()); dir == "" {
return notFoundError("pid file")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
if dir := filepath.Dir(c.LogFilename()); dir == "" {
return notFoundError("log file")
} else if err := fs.MkdirAll(dir); err != nil {
return createError(dir, err)
}
if c.DarktableEnabled() {
if dir, err := c.CreateDarktableCachePath(); err != nil {
return fmt.Errorf("could not create darktable cache path %s", clean.Log(dir))
}
if dir, err := c.CreateDarktableConfigPath(); err != nil {
return fmt.Errorf("could not create darktable cache path %s", clean.Log(dir))
}
}
return nil
}

// StoragePath returns the path for generated files like cache and index.
func (c *Config) StoragePath() string {
if c.options.StoragePath == "" {
const dirName = "storage"
// Default directories.
originalsDir := fs.Abs(filepath.Join(c.OriginalsPath(), fs.PPHiddenPathname, dirName))
storageDir := fs.Abs(dirName)
// Find existing directories.
if fs.PathWritable(originalsDir) && !c.ReadOnly() {
return originalsDir
} else if fs.PathWritable(storageDir) && c.ReadOnly() {
return storageDir
}
// Fallback to backup storage path.
if fs.PathWritable(c.options.BackupPath) {
return fs.Abs(filepath.Join(c.options.BackupPath, dirName))
}
// Use .photoprism in home directory?
if usr, _ := user.Current(); usr.HomeDir != "" {
p := fs.Abs(filepath.Join(usr.HomeDir, fs.PPHiddenPathname, dirName))
if fs.PathWritable(p) || c.ReadOnly() {
return p
}
}
// Fallback directory in case nothing else works.
if c.ReadOnly() {
return fs.Abs(filepath.Join(fs.PPHiddenPathname, dirName))
}
// Store cache and index in "originals/.photoprism/storage".
return originalsDir
}
return fs.Abs(c.options.StoragePath)
}
